Abstract
BACKGROUND/OBJECTIVES Long-standing groin pain is a severe issue for athletes, often associated with the cleft sign on magnetic resonance imaging (MRI) scans, yet its underlying causes are poorly understood. The purpose of this study is to histologically examine the pubic plate structure in cadavers with and without the cleft sign on MRI, shedding light on the pathology behind the cleft sign. METHODS Three fresh human pelvic cadavers underwent 3.0T MRI to detect the cleft sign before histological dissection of pubic plates. Pubic plate tissues were fixed in formalin, decalcified, and processed. Of the two cleft sign-negative specimens, one was cut into sagittal sections, and the other was cut into coronal sections for histology. For the cleft sign positive specimen, a sagittal section was cut. Moreover, 5 µm thick sections were cut at different axial levels for each orientation. Sections were subjected to Safranin O, Alcian blue, and Herovici's staining or hematoxylin and eosin staining. RESULTS MRI confirmed that one specimen had a cleft sign in the inferior region on both sides of the pubis and that two specimens had no cleft sign. Both sagittal and coronal sections showed the presence of a cartilage structure continuing from the pubic symphysis to 3 mm laterally within the pubic plate. In the specimen with a positive cleft sign, cartilage damage within the pubic symphysis and pubic plate was identified as revealed by Safranin O staining, Herovici's staining, and H&E staining. CONCLUSIONS This study elucidated the existence of a cartilage component extending from the pubic symphysis to the pubic plate. The cleft sign in MRI correlated with a disruption in the cartilage component in histology within this specific area.

Abstract
OBJECTIVE To compare dedicated MRI with targeted fluoroscopic guided symphyseal contrast agent injection regarding the assessment of symphyseal cleft signs in men with athletic groin pain and assessment of radiographic pelvic ring instability. METHODS Sixty-six athletic men were prospectively included after an initial clinical examination by an experienced surgeon using a standardized procedure. Diagnostic fluoroscopic symphyseal injection of a contrast agent was performed. Additionally, standing single-leg stance radiography and dedicated 3-Tesla MRI protocol were employed. The presence of cleft injuries (superior, secondary, combined, atypical) and osteitis pubis was recorded. RESULTS Symphyseal bone marrow edema (BME) was present in 50 patients, bilaterally in 41 patients and in 28 with an asymmetrical distribution. Comparison of MRI and symphysography was as followed: no clefts: 14 cases (MRI) vs. 24 cases (symphysography), isolated superior cleft sign: 13 vs. 10, isolated secondary cleft sign: 15 vs. 21 cases and combined injuries: 18 vs. 11 cases. In 7 cases a combined cleft sign was observed in MRI but only an isolated secondary cleft sign was visible in symphysography. Anterior pelvic ring instability was observed in 25 patients and was linked to a cleft sign in 23 cases (7 superior cleft sign, 8 secondary cleft signs, 6 combined clefts, 2 atypical cleft injuries). Additional BME could be diagnosed in 18 of those 23. CONCLUSION Dedicated 3-Tesla MRI outmatches symphysography for purely diagnostic purposes of cleft injuries. Microtearing at the prepubic aponeurotic complex and the presence of BME is a prerequisite for the development of anterior pelvic ring instability. CLINICAL RELEVANCE STATEMENT For diagnostic of symphyseal cleft injuries dedicated 3-T MRI protocols outmatch fluoroscopic symphysography. Prior specific clinical examination is highly beneficial and additional flamingo view x-rays are recommended for assessment of pelvic ring instability in these patients. KEY POINTS • Assessment of symphyseal cleft injuries is more accurate by use of dedicated MRI as compared to fluoroscopic symphysography. • Additional fluoroscopy may be important for therapeutic injections. • The presence of cleft injury might be a prerequisite for the development of pelvic ring instability.

Abstract
Background Osteitis pubis (OP) is inflammation of pubic symphysis associated with varying degrees of supra-pubic, pelvic, or lower abdominal pain. The condition may be severe in many patients with significant disability and protracted course of recovery. The condition is frequently described in sportspersons or athletes but consensus on classification and treatment guidelines is non-existent due to rarity of the condition. Its presence in non-athletic population is limited to a series of few cases or anecdotal case reports. Our study describes salient features of pattern of this disorder diagnosed on clinico-radiological basis in cases referred from primary care centers to our tertiary care center. Materials and Method A total of 26 patients (mean age of 36.28 years, 25 females, and 1 male case) with radiological features suggestive of OP were included in the study and relevant demographic details were noted for each. A radiological grading (Grade A to E) for notification was developed and the cases were categorized accordingly. Results Most of the cases were hard-working women from villages. Pregnancy was the major condition for which they ever consulted a health-care facility. Chronic, but not disabling, supra-pubic pain was the chief complaint in most cases. In some cases, the primary presentation was for some other disorder like low back pain in two, hip pain in six cases, adjacent fracture in three, and old lumbar osteoporotic compression fracture in one case. Other notable associated disorders included polio, ankylosing spondylitis, femoroacetabular impingement, and hip dysplasia. Conservative management was done in all cases except one with associated fracture. Good clinical outcome was noted in all but one case. Grade A cases were maximum (7) followed by grade B (6), grade D (4), and grade C (3). Only one case of grade E was noted with almost ankylosed symphysis. Conclusion This article highlights acknowledgment and knowledge of OP in primary care settings and its anticipation even in normal population for a better understanding of prevalence and radiological presentation.

Abstract
CLINICAL/METHODICAL ISSUE Groin pain in athletes can have various causes. Radiologically, osteitis pubis and clefts with affection of the interpubic disc as well as muscle and tendon tears near the pubic bone can be clearly identified. STANDARD RADIOLOGICAL METHODS Magnetic resonance imaging (MRI) is the imaging modality of choice, as well as single-leg stand imaging (flamingo view radiographs), and where appropriate symphysography. METHODICAL INNOVATIONS Optimized MRI sequence protocol with oblique (axial oblique) slices parallel to the linea arcuata of the iliac bone is recommended. High-resolution MRI sequences and symphysography can detect superior and secondary cleft formation. Instabilities of the pubic symphysis can be diagnosed using flamingo view radiographs. PERFORMANCE The MRI findings of osteitis pubis and clinical symptoms correlate. The presence of parasymphyseal bone marrow edema is the earliest morphological sign of acute osteitis pubis on MR imaging. Edema in the periosteal tissue and isolated muscle lesions next to the symphysis are generally associated with more severe clinical symptoms. ACHIEVEMENTS AND PRACTICAL RECOMMENDATIONS Close communication between radiologists and the referring physicians is indispensable when planning an adequate imaging protocol, and precise knowledge of the clinical symptoms in the case of clinical suspicion of osteitis pubis allows for a reliable diagnosis and provides important prognostic information.

Abstract
BACKGROUND The objectives of this study were: (1) to determine whether athletes with stage 1 osteitis pubis (OP) present differences in hip range of motion (ROM) and muscle strength, between both sides and compared with healthy athletes; (2) to investigate the relationship between the internal rotation (IR) ROM and pain intensity and physical function. METHODS a cross-sectional and correlational study was designed, in which 30 athletes (15 athletes with stage 1 OP and 15 healthy athletes) were included. Pain intensity, physical function, hip ROM and hip muscle strength were assessed. RESULTS The ROM assessment reported significant differences between both groups in the IR, external rotation (ER) and adduction (ADD) ROM of the painful side (PS) (p < 0.05). The OP group showed differences between both sides in IR ER and ADD ROM (p < 0.05). No statistically significant differences were found between or within groups in the maximum isometric strength of the hip (p > 0.05). A strong negative correlation between pain intensity and IR ROM (r = -0.640) and a strong positive correlation between physical function and IR ROM (r = 0.563) were found in the OP group. CONCLUSIONS Male athletes with stage 1 OP present a hip IR, ER and ADD ROM limitation in the PS compared to non-PS and to healthy athletes. IR ROM is correlated to pain intensity and physical function in athletes with stage 1 OP.

Abstract
Objective The objective of this study is to summarise the contemporary evidence regarding the prevalence, diagnosis, and management of osteitis pubis (OP) specially from urological point of view, while proposing an algorithm for the best management based on the current evidence. Methods We performed a literature search using the PubMed database for the term 'osteitis pubis' until December 2020. We assessed pre-clinical and clinical studies regarding the aetiology, pathophysiology, and management of OP. Case reports and case series were evaluated by study quality and patient outcomes to determine a potential clinical management algorithm. Results Osteitis pubis is a chronic painful condition of the symphysis pubis joint and its surrounding structures. Still, there is a paucity of data outlining the management plan and the possible triggers. The aetiology seems to be multifactorial with different proposals trying to explain the pathophysiology and correlate the findings to the outcome. The diagnosis is usually based on high suspicion index and clinical experience. The infective variant of the disease is aggressive and requires strict and active management. Universal consensus is still lacking regarding a formal algorithm of management of the condition, especially due to multiple specialities involved in the decision-making process. Conservative management remains the cornerstone; nevertheless, surgical interventions may be needed in special settings. Hence, a multi-disciplinary approach is of pivotal value in fashioning the plan for each case. The prognosis is usually satisfactory; however, a longstanding debilitating disease form is not uncommon. Conclusion OP remains a rare condition with real challenges in its diagnosis. The current management is focused on conservative management; however, surgical intervention is still needed in some difficult scenarios. Continued research into the triggers of OP, multidisciplinary approach, and standardised clinical pathways can improve the quality of care for patients suffering from this condition.

Abstract
Osteitis pubis (OP) is a self-limiting, noninfectious inflammatory disease of the pubic symphysis and the surrounding soft tissues that usually improves with activity modification and targeted conservative treatment. Surgical treatment is required for a limited number of patients. This study aims to investigate the current literature on the surgical treatment of OP in athletes. A systematic review was conducted on two databases (MEDLINE/PubMed and Google Scholar) from 2000 to 2021. The inclusion criteria were adult patients with athletic OP who underwent surgical treatment and studies published in English. The exclusion criteria included pregnancy, infection OP, or postoperative complications related to other surgical interventions, such as urological or gynecological complications. Fifty-one surgically treated cases have been reported in eight studies, which included short-term, mid-term, and long-term studies ranging from one patient to 23 patients. The surgical treatment methods were as follows: (a) pubic symphysis arthrodesis, (b) open or endoscopic pubic symphysectomy, (c) wedge resection of the pubic symphysis, and (d) polypropylene mesh placed into the preperitoneal retropubic space endoscopically. The main indication for surgical intervention was failure of conservative measures and long-lasting pain, disability, and inability to participate in athletic activities. Wedge resection of the pubic symphysis has been the less preferred surgical treatment in the recently published literature. The most common surgical method of treatment of OP in athletes, which entailed the existence of posterior stability of the sacroiliac joint, in the current literature is open pubic symphysis curettage. Recently, there has been a tendency for pubic symphysis curettage to be performed endoscopically.

Abstract
Background Despite being a common overuse entity in youth soccer, scientific data on risk factors, rehabilitation and return to play for long-standing pubic-related groin pain is still rare. The current prospective cohort study aims to evaluate potential risk-factors, propose a criteria-based conservative rehabilitation protocol and assess return-to-play outcomes among professional youth soccer players suffering from long-standing pubic-related groin pain. Methods Male soccer players with long-standing (> 6 weeks) pubic-related groin pain from a professional soccer club’s youth academy were analyzed for possible risk factors such as age, team (U12 - U23), younger/older age group within the team, position and preinjury Functional movement score. All injured players received a conservative, standardized, supervised, criteria-based, 6-level rehabilitation program. Outcome measures included time to return to play, recurrent groin pain in the follow-up period and clinical results at final follow-up two years after their return to play. Results A total of 14 out of 189 players developed long-standing pubic-related groin pain in the 2017/2018 season (incidence 7.4%). The average age of the players at the time of the injury was 16.1 ± 1.9 years. Risk factor analysis revealed a significant influence of the age group within the team (p = .007). Only players in the younger age group were affected by long-standing pubic-related groin pain, mainly in the first part of the season. Injured players successfully returned to play after an average period of 135.3 ± 83.9 days. Only one player experienced a recurrence of nonspecific symptoms (7.1%) within the follow-up period. The outcome at the 24-month follow-up was excellent for all 14 players. Conclusions Long-standing pubic-related groin pain is an overuse entity with a markedly high prevalence in youth soccer players, resulting in a relevant loss of time in training and match play. In particular, the youngest players in each team are at an elevated risk. Applying a criteria-based rehabilitation protocol resulted in an excellent return-to-play rate, with a very low probability of recurrence. Abstract
PURPOSE To investigate the prevalence of magnetic resonance imaging (MRI) findings and define prognostic factors of the return-to-play time in young athletes with groin pain. METHODS A total of 1091 consecutive athletes were retrospectively screened; 651 athletes, aged 16-40 years, with pain in the groin regions were assessed using MRI. Of these athletes, 356 were included for analysing the time to return-to-play. Univariate and multiple linear regression analyses were used to determine the associations between the time to return-to-play (primary outcome variable) and the following variables: age, sex, body mass index, type of sports, Hip Sports Activity Scale, clear trauma history, and 12 MRI findings. RESULTS Four MRI findings, including cleft sign, pubic bone marrow oedema of both the superior and inferior ramus, and central disc protrusion of the pubic symphysis, appeared together in more than 44% of the cases. The median time to return-to-play was 24.7 weeks for athletes with a cleft sign on MRI, which was significantly longer than the 11.9 weeks for athletes without the sign. The median time to return-to-play was 20.8 weeks for athletes with BMI > 24, which was significantly longer than the 13.6 weeks for athletes with BMI ≦ 24. In multiple linear regression analysis of 356 athletes, in whom hip-related groin pain was excluded, and who were followed-up until the return-to-play, the body mass index and cleft sign were the independent factors associated with a delayed return-to-play. In contrast, iliopsoas muscle strain and other muscle injuries were associated with a shorter return-to-play. CONCLUSIONS Multiple MRI findings were present in almost half of all cases. Body mass index and the cleft sign were independently associated with a delayed return-to-play time in young athletes suffering from groin pain. LEVEL OF EVIDENCE III.

Abstract
CLINICAL/METHODICAL ISSUE Osteitis pubis is one of the most common causes of chronic groin pain in many professional athletes. Symphysitis pubis with instability of the joint due to softening of the joint capsule and muscular imbalance of the corresponding muscles increases the instability of the sympyseal region, thus, resulting in a vicious cycle. STANDARD RADIOLOGICAL METHODS Magnetic resonance imaging (MRI). METHODICAL INNOVATIONS Optimized MRI sequence protocol with oblique (axial oblique) layers parallel to the linea arcuata of iliac bone together with large image field for depiction of the entire pelvis and high-resolution sequences focused on the symphysis pubis. PERFORMANCE Recently, the correlation between MRI signs of osteitis pubis and long-term clinical outcome in a group of professional soccer players was examined. In particular, edema in the peri-osseous tissue and isolated muscle lesions around the symphysis at the onset of symptoms were associated with partial recovery of the athletes. Furthermore, a significant association of increased normalized signal intensity in the pubic bone on STIR (short-tau inversion recovery) sequences (corresponding presence and signal intensity of bone marrow edema) and a poor complete clinical improvement was observed. ACHIEVEMENTS An optimized MRI protocol allows the diagnosis of osteitis pubis and provides important prognostic information. PRACTICAL RECOMMENDATIONS In case of clinical suspicion on osteitis pubis, MR imaging with an optimized sequence protocol should be performed.

Abstract
BACKGROUND The decreased hip range of motion seen in femoroacetabular impingement syndrome (FAIS) may lead to compensatory increased motion at the symphysis pubis (SP) with resultant increased stress on the joint, which can subsequently lead to osteitis pubis. PURPOSE To quantify the prevalence of SP abnormalities in patients with FAIS through the use of imaging modalities and to compare outcomes based on the presence of SP abnormalities. STUDY DESIGN Cohort study; Level of evidence, 3. METHODS Radiographs and magnetic resonance imaging (MRI) scans of 1009 consecutive patients who underwent primary hip arthroscopy for FAIS from January 2012 to January 2016 were identified. Exclusion criteria were patients undergoing revision or bilateral surgery, patients with dysplasia, and patients with less than 2-year follow-up. On radiographs, SP joints were reviewed for joint surface erosions, subchondral sclerosis and cysts, and ankylosis. MRI scans were reviewed for marrow edema in the subarticular pubic bone, subchondral sclerosis and cysts, joint surface erosions, and ankylosis. Patients with SP abnormalities were matched 1:2 to patients without SP abnormalities by age and body mass index. Outcomes included the Hip Outcome Score-Activities of Daily Living (HOS-ADL), HOS-Sports Subscale (HOS-SS), modified Harris Hip Score (mHHS), International Hip Outcome Tool-12 (iHOT-12), and visual analog scales (VAS) for pain and satisfaction. RESULTS 830 patients were included; 23 (2.8%) demonstrated SP abnormalities. Of the 726 (72%) MRI scans reviewed, 15 (1.8%) showed bone marrow edema, subchondral sclerosis, erosions, or ankylosis. After matching, patients without SP abnormalities had significantly greater HOS-ADL (95.7 vs 83.0; P = .008), HOS-SS (91.6 vs 61.9; P = .003), iHOT-12 (89.5 vs 74.6; P = .046), and VAS satisfaction (91.3 vs 58.8; P = .004) scores, in addition to less postoperative pain (6.3 vs 23.5; P < .001). No significant differences were found in the mHHS (92.5 vs 82.2; P = .08). Patients without SP abnormalities had higher odds of achieving the minimal clinically important difference for the HOS-ADL (odds ratio [OR], 4.5; 95% CI, 1.3-14.1; P = .010), the HOS-SS (OR, 7.2; 95% CI, 1.8-18.5; P = .006), and the mHHS (OR, 14.5; 95% CI, 1.8-24.7; P = .013). CONCLUSION A low prevalence (1.8%-2.6%) of SP joint abnormality is seen on imaging in patients with FAIS. These patients may demonstrate significantly inferior clinical outcomes and persistent postoperative pain after FAIS treatment.

Abstract
Objectives We aimed to prospectively evaluate the prevalence of long-standing groin pain and related MRI findings in contact sports. Methods This case–control study followed three male elite-level soccer, ice-hockey and bandy teams (102 players) for 2 years. All athletes with long-standing groin pain lasting >30 days and age-matched controls (1:3) from the same teams were examined clinically, using pelvic MRI and Hip and Groin Outcome Scores (HAGOS). Primary outcome measures were annual prevalence of groin pain and underlying MRI findings. Results The annual prevalence of chronic groin pain was 7.5%. Training characteristics and pain scores of athletes were similar in all teams. On MRI, there was no significant difference in the percentage of pubic bone marrow oedema (p = 0.80) between symptomatic players (8/15; 53%) versus controls (20/43; 47%), but adductor tendinopathy and degenerative changes at the pubic symphysis were twice more common among players with pain. Rectus muscle or iliopsoas pathology were seldom observed. Lower HAGOS subscales (p < 0.01) were recorded in players who experienced groin pain compared with the controls. Conclusion Long-standing groin pain was observed annually in 1 of 14 athletes in contact sports. Abnormalities in the pubic symphysis were common MRI findings in both symptomatic and asymptomatic players. Trial registration number NCT02560480

Abstract
Objective To quantify standard values of the discus interpubicus in healthy subjects and to determine reliability and repeatability using T2 relaxation time measurements at 3T. Methods 20 asymptomatic participants (10 male, 10 female; mean age: 27.3 years ±4.1, BMI: 22.2 ±1.8) underwent a 3T Magnetic Resonance Imaging (MRI) of the pelvic region in a supine position. We included sagittal and para-axial T2w sequences centred over the pubic symphysis in order to identify the complete discus interpubicus. For quantitative analysis, a multi-echo Turbo Spin Echo (TSE) sequence (including 12 echo times between 6.4 and 76.8 ms) was acquired and analysed by using an in-house developed quantification plugin tool (qMapIt) extending ImageJ. Two readers in consensus defined three central slices of the pubic symphysis with the greatest length. For each slice, both readers separately placed three regions-of-interest (ROI) covering the whole discus interpubicus. Both readers repeated the ROI placements in identical fashion after a four-week interval on the original MRI images. Statistical analysis included intraclass correlation coefficient (ICC), nonparametric Wilcoxon test, Fisher exact test and mean relaxation time in ms and 95% confidence intervals. Results T2 relaxation time analysis was performed for all 20 participants. In total, a mean relaxation time of all analysed segments for both observers was 48.6 (±6.3 ms), with a mean relaxation time for observer 1 of 48.7 (±6.0 ms) and for observer 2 of 48.5 ms (±6.6ms). The calculated ICC comparing inter- and intrarater reproducibility was excellent in all segments (≥0.75). Conclusion T2 mapping of the discus interpubicus demonstrates good inter- and intrarater repeatability as well as reliability. Mean relaxation times were calculated with 48.6ms in healthy volunteers.

Abstract
PURPOSE OF REVIEW To discuss the clinical significance of the most common hip and groin injuries in baseball players, as well as an algorithmic approach to diagnosis and treatment of these injuries. RECENT FINDINGS (a) Limitations in throwing velocity, pitch control, and bat swing speed may be secondary to decreased mobility and strength within the proximal kinetic chain, which must harness power from the lower extremities and core. (b) Approximately 5.5% of all baseball injuries per year involve the hip/groin and may lead to a significant amount of time spent on the disabled list. Injuries involving the hip and groin are relatively common in baseball players. Our knowledge of the mechanics of overhead throwing continues to evolve, as does our understanding of the contribution of power from the lower extremities and core. It is paramount that the team physician be able to accurately diagnose and treat injuries involving the hip/groin, as they may lead to significant disability and inability to return to elite levels of play. This review focuses on hip- and groin-related injuries in the baseball player, including femoroacetabular impingement, core muscle injury, and osteitis pubis.
